    Qualification Description

    This qualification provides a trade outcome in wall and floor tiling for residential and commercial construction work. The qualification has core unit of competency requirements that cover common skills for the construction industry, as well as the specialist field of work, wall and floor tiling. Tilers work with materials like ceramic, glass, slate, marble and clay. They cut these materials and lay tiles on walls and floors, both interior and exterior. They may also add decorative touches to their basic work

    Occupational titles may include:  

    • Tiler
    • Wall and Floor tiler.

    State and territory jurisdictions may have different licensing, legislative, regulatory or certification requirements. Relevant state and territory regulatory authorities should be consulted to confirm those requirements.

    This qualification is suitable for an Australian apprenticeship pathway.

    Completion of the general construction induction training program, specified in the Safe Work Australia model Code of Practice: Construction Work, is required by anyone carrying out construction work. Achievement of CPCWHS1001 Prepare to work safely in the construction industry meets this requirement.

    Course Structure

    A total of 20 Units (17 Core and 3 electives) must be completed and deemed competent to achieve the qualification CPC31320 – Certificate III in Wall and Floor Tiling. Participants who achieve competency in any unit/s will receive a Statement of Attainment (provided USI is verified) for that unit/s without completing all the units in the qualification. Students completing all the required units of competency will attain full qualification.

    Core Unit Codes Unit Name
    CPCCCM2006 Apply basic levelling procedures
    CPCCOM1012 Work effectively and sustainably in the construction industry
    CPCCOM1013 Plan and organise work
    CPCCOM1014 Conduct workplace communication
    CPCCOM1015 Carry out measurements and calculations
    CPCCOM2001* Read and interpret plans and specifications
    CPCCWF2001* Handle wall and floor tiling materials
    CPCCWF2002* Use wall and floor tiling tools and equipment
    CPCCWF3001* Prepare surfaces for tiling application
    CPCCWF3002* Install floor tiles
    CPCCWF3003* Install wall tiles
    CPCCWF3004* Repair wall and floor tiling
    CPCCWF3005* Install decorative tiling
    CPCCWF3006* Install mosaic tiling
    CPCCWF3007* Tile curved surfaces
    CPCCWF3009* Apply waterproofing for wall and floor tiling
    CPCCWHS2001 Apply WHS requirements, policies and procedures in the construction industry
    Elective Unit Codes Unit Name
    BSBESB301 Investigate business opportunities
    CPCCCM2008* Erect and dismantle restricted height scaffolding
    CPCCCM2012* Work safely at heights
